OK, here's the problem. These guys have SO many projects in their history that I don't even really know how to dig into the obscurities to find what good music may be found there... of course we all know of the Saafi Brothers project which is totally excellent - so the question I'd like to ask is, are any of these other projects as good? Can anyone single out some good individual tracks from any of these names?

I consulted discogs to get this massive list...

13 Moons, Gab!, G˛, Aural Float, Dub Connected, Dub Mix Convention, Futuristic Dub Foundation, Gabriel Le Mar & Pascal F.E.O.S., Montauk P, Saafi Brothers, Supercruizer, B-Flame, Camou, Eternal Basement, Fünf D, Lasziv, Magnat, Masun, Negative Return, Paragon, S.M.I.L.E., Subscientists, AR006351, Dubbelhelix, Ebsg, Taklamakan, Target, Trasher X, Tronic, Ultraworld, Winston D.

Soooo... what's good?

Magnat album on Qube records its a personal favorite of mine from Michael Kohlbecker, check it out, its good deep tech shit.
Masun is too hadrcore for me.
Dub Connected by Gabriel is a very strong project also, watch out every album he released under this name on Nova Tekk.
Supercruizer on Electrolux Rec also have nice moments, more into classic techno direction.

all in all those guys know what is good music...

Gabriel Le Mar - Hear And Now has some great moments.. Experience the Lightness is grooving phat housey flavour.. Travelogue is downbeat, hypnotic dub with nice guitar work.. Into deep is sumptuous, floating ambient, again with soothing guitar floatings and drifting beauty.. Journey To Eurasia is more great ambient as is the closing Here and Now...

Well worth a listen if you like Saafi Brothers with a bit of house and techiness..            - - It's nice to be important, but it's more important to be nice... - -
